It doesn't support JAVA specifically. I would assume Java could automate it
as a COM application.

for you second question.

you can copy your first list and then use vlookup with it for the second

assume you put ID and Name on Sheet2 starting in A1 and ID and address are
on Sheet1 in C1:D200

in C1 of Sheet2
=if(iserror(match(A1,Sheet1!$C$1:$C$200,0)),"Null",Vlookup(A1,Sheet1!$C$1:$D
$200,2,false))

then drag fill this down the column.
